Abstract:
FP-injective modules act in ways similar to injective modules. Therefore, through-out
this document we investigate many of these properties of FP-injective modules which
are modelled after those similar properties of injective modules. The results we develop
can be broken into two categories: FP-injective Modules and Localization of FP-injective
Modules.
